
GTECH completes acquisition of Leeward Islands Lottery
Thursday, May 6, 2004
WEST GREENWICH, USA: GTECH Holdings
Corporation today announced that it has completed the acquisition of
privately-held Leeward Islands Lottery Holding Company Inc. (LILHCo), a
lottery operating company headquartered in Antigua and St. Croix. The
enterprise purchase price for LILHCo was an all-cash transaction of
approximately $40 million. "Long term, our
strategy is to become a leading supplier of gaming technology solutions for
government customers," said GTECH President and CEO W. Bruce Turner. "As part
of that effort, the acquisition of Caribbean-based LILHCo will enhance our
strategic foothold in that region, as well as provide significant growth
opportunities in additional jurisdictions throughout the Caribbean.
GTECH continues to expect that LILHCo will provide a gross revenue
contribution of $20 million to $25 million, representing gross lottery ticket
sales, and a net revenue contribution of $6 million to $8 million, for the
current fiscal year ending February 26, 2005. GTECH also expects the
transaction to be earnings neutral for this fiscal year.
